Event Day Information
Race Date: June 19, 2027
Race Location: Peace Park (8 Street SW & 2 Ave SW)
Start Times:
8:30 a.m. – 1K Little Steps
8:50 a.m. – Welcome and Warm-up
9:15 a.m. – 10K start
9:40 a.m. – 5K start
Suggested Arrival Time: 7:45 a.m.
To have the most enjoyable race day experience, please give yourself plenty of time before your race. Factor in timing for: getting to the event site, parking, toilet use (which may include wait time), getting into your start corral, deep breathing and getting into your groove!
Parking Information
The closest parking options to Peace Park (located at 2 Ave & 8 St SW in Eau Claire) are operated by the Calgary Parking Authority (CPA).
The closest lots are Lot 6 (Louise Bridge) and Lot 71 (Downtown), which offer affordable weekend day rates but have specific capacities.
Parking Options Near Peace Park
- CPA Lot 6 (Louise Bridge)
- Location: 311 8 Street SW (directly adjacent to the park).
- Capacity: 207 stalls (including 1 accessible stall).
- Saturday Cost: $1.00 per hour between 6:00 AM and 6:00 PM, up to a maximum daytime
- flat rate of $2.00. After 6:00 PM, the evening rate is $1.00 per hour up to a $2.00 maximum.
- CPA Lot 71 (Downtown)
- Location: 603 3 Avenue SW (roughly one block south of the park).
- Capacity: 50 stalls total (25 indoor and 25 outdoor).
- Saturday Cost: $1.00 per hour ($0.50 per half-hour) between 6:00 AM and 6:00 PM.
- Evening rates after 6:00 PM drop to $1.00 per hour up to a $3.00 maximum.
- CPA Lot 58 (Downtown)
- Location: 935 4 Avenue SW (a short walk southwest of the park).
- Capacity: Specific stall count is unlisted by CPA, but it serves as an alternative outdoor surface lot option.
- Saturday Cost: $1.00 per hour ($0.50 per half-hour) from 6:00 AM to 6:00 PM, and $1.00 per hour for evenings.
On-Street Parking Alternative
Alternatively, Calgary Parking Authority pricing for on-street parking on Saturdays is in effect from 9:00 AM to 6:00 PM. Pricing varies strictly by the specific block zone, but it becomes entirely free after 6:00 PM and all day on Sundays.

The Shoppers Drug Mart® Run for Women thanks you for participating and donating to support a local women’s mental health program in your community! To date, we’ve raised over $23 million for women’s mental health programs in 18 cities across Canada, helping to improve access for women who need mental health support.
